Types of Sanders for Woodworking

When it comes to woodworking sanders, there are several types to choose from, each serving a unique purpose. Belt sanders are among the most powerful options available. They consist of a continuous loop of sandpaper that moves rapidly over a flat surface, making them ideal for removing material quickly and efficiently.

If you have large, flat surfaces to smooth out, a belt sander is your best bet. However, due to their aggressive nature, they require careful handling to avoid gouging the wood. Random orbital sanders are another popular choice among woodworkers.

These versatile tools combine circular motion with an orbital pattern, allowing for a smooth finish without leaving swirl marks. They are perfect for both rough sanding and fine finishing, making them a go-to option for many projects. If you are looking for a sander that can handle various tasks with ease, a random orbital sander might be the right fit for you.

Palm sanders, also known as finishing sanders, are smaller and more lightweight than their counterparts. They are designed for precision work and are perfect for sanding edges and corners. Their compact size allows for easy maneuverability, making them ideal for detailed projects where control is essential.

If you often find yourself working on intricate designs or small pieces of wood, a palm sander could be an invaluable addition to your toolkit. Detail sanders are specifically designed for tight spaces and intricate work. With their pointed tips and small sanding pads, they can reach areas that larger sanders cannot.

If you have projects that involve intricate carvings or detailed work, investing in a detail sander will save you time and effort while ensuring a smooth finish in those hard-to-reach spots.

Factors to Consider When Choosing a Woodworking Sander

Selecting the right woodworking sander involves considering several factors that can impact your project’s outcome. One of the most critical aspects is the type of project you are undertaking. For instance, if you are working on large surfaces like tabletops or cabinets, a belt sander may be more suitable due to its power and efficiency.

Conversely, if your project involves intricate details or fine finishes, a palm or detail sander would be more appropriate. Another important factor is the sander’s power and speed settings. Different projects may require varying levels of aggressiveness when sanding.

A sander with adjustable speed settings allows you to tailor its performance to your specific needs. This flexibility can help prevent damage to delicate wood surfaces while still providing enough power for tougher jobs. Weight and ergonomics also play a significant role in your choice of sander.

A heavier sander may provide more stability during use but can also lead to fatigue over extended periods. On the other hand, a lightweight sander may be easier to handle but could lack the power needed for certain tasks. Finding a balance between weight and comfort is essential for maintaining productivity and ensuring that you can work efficiently without straining yourself.

Tips for Using Sanders in Woodworking Projects

Using sanders effectively requires some knowledge and technique to achieve optimal results in your woodworking projects. One essential tip is to always start with coarse grit sandpaper when tackling rough surfaces or removing material quickly. Gradually progress to finer grits as you refine the finish; this approach will help prevent damage to the wood while ensuring a smooth surface.

Another important aspect is maintaining consistent pressure while sanding; applying too much force can lead to uneven surfaces or gouges in the wood grain. Instead, let the weight of the sander do most of the work while moving it steadily across the surface in overlapping passes. Additionally, always keep an eye on dust accumulation during sanding sessions; excessive dust buildup can hinder performance and lead to poor results.

Regularly check your dust collection system or empty bags as needed to maintain optimal airflow throughout your workspace. Finally, don’t forget about safety precautions when using sanders; wearing protective eyewear and a dust mask will help safeguard against harmful particles released during sanding operations.

Maintenance and Care for Woodworking Sanders

Proper maintenance of your woodworking sanders is crucial for ensuring their longevity and optimal performance over time. One key aspect of maintenance involves regularly checking and replacing worn-out sandpaper; using dull or damaged paper can lead to poor results and increased wear on your tool. Cleaning your sander after each use is also essential; dust buildup can affect performance and lead to overheating issues if left unchecked.

Use compressed air or a soft brush to remove debris from vents and other hard-to-reach areas after each session. Additionally, inspect power cords regularly for any signs of wear or damage; frayed cords can pose safety hazards during operation. If you notice any issues with electrical components or functionality, consult the manufacturer’s guidelines before attempting repairs yourself.

Finally, store your sanders properly when not in use; keeping them in a dry environment away from extreme temperatures will help prevent rusting or damage over time.

What grit sandpaper should I use with woodworking sanders?

The grit of sandpaper varies depending on the stage of sanding. Coarse grits (40-60) are used for heavy material removal, medium grits (80-120) for smoothing surfaces, and fine grits (150-220 and above) for finishing and preparing wood for staining or painting.

Are cordless sanders effective for woodworking?

Yes, cordless sanders can be effective for woodworking, especially for portability and convenience. However, they may have less power and shorter run times compared to corded models, so consider the scope of your project when choosing between cordless and corded sanders.

How important is dust collection in woodworking sanders?

Dust collection is very important as it helps keep the work area clean, improves visibility, and reduces health risks associated with wood dust. Many modern sanders come with built-in dust collection systems or can be connected to external vacuum systems.

Can I use the same sander for both rough and fine sanding?

While some sanders, like random orbital sanders, can handle both rough and fine sanding by changing the grit of the sandpaper, specialized sanders may perform better for specific tasks. It’s often beneficial to have more than one type of sander for different stages of woodworking.

What safety precautions should I take when using a woodworking sander?

Always wear safety goggles, a dust mask or respirator, and hearing protection when using a sander. Ensure the workpiece is securely clamped, keep fingers away from moving parts, and work in a well-ventilated area to minimize dust inhalation.

How often should I replace sanding pads or belts?

Sanding pads or belts should be replaced when they become worn, torn, or clogged with dust and debris, as this reduces their effectiveness. The frequency depends on usage intensity and the type of material being sanded.

Can sanding damage the wood surface?

Yes, improper sanding techniques, such as using too coarse a grit or applying excessive pressure, can damage the wood surface by creating scratches or uneven areas. It’s important to sand progressively with finer grits and use the appropriate sander for the task.
